"Live at the Flevo Festival - Eindhoven, Holland - August 17, 2001. Four high-res digital cameras put you there along with 12,000 excited fans. Great stereo sound. Live at the Kit Carson Amphitheater - Escondido, CA - June 29, 1991. Be there for the very first Tourniquet show ever - complete and uncut. Hear all the classics from Tourniquet's debut release 'Stop the Bleeding'. PLUS - for the first time on digital format - Ark of Suffering - the music video that brought the horrors of animal abuse to the attention of thousands and made them rethink our treatment of God's creation."
